From Vaux-Sur-Seine to Chevreuse by RER and bus
To get from Vaux-Sur-Seine to Chevreuse in Paris, you’ll need to take one bus line and 2 RER lines: take the 6542 bus from Le Temple station to Gare Routière Nord (C1) station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the A RER and finally take the B RER from Châtelet Les Halles station to Saint-Rémy-Lès-Chevreuse station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 2 hr 32 min.
